Stress Laundering Timber Surfaces



When stress washing wood surfaces, it's crucial to choose the ideal tools and method to avoid damage. Start by choosing a pressure washing machine with flexible settings. A lower stress, usually in between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is optimal for wood. This helps protect against gouging or removing the wood fibers.

Before you start, ensure to get rid of the area of furnishings, plants, and other barriers. It's important to check a little, unnoticeable section initially to ensure your method and stress settings will not damage the surface.

Use a fan nozzle add-on for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at the very least 12 inches away from the timber to lessen the risk of damages.

As you wash, move in long, sweeping activities along the grain of the wood. This technique assists lift dirt and particles effectively without leaving touches.

Permit the wood to dry completely prior to applying any sealer or tarnish. Following these steps will certainly ensure your wood surface areas stay in fantastic condition while looking fresh and clean.

Techniques for Cleaning Concrete



Concrete surface areas can collect dirt, grime, and stains in time, making effective cleaning techniques essential. To begin, you'll want to utilize a pressure wash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This level of stress effectively eliminates persistent stains without damaging the surface.

Before you start,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of detergent and water. Next off, affix a vast spray nozzle to your stress washing machine, ideally a 25-degree or 40-degree idea. This will certainly distribute the water uniformly and minimize the danger of etching.



When you start pressure cleaning, operate in areas. Keep the nozzle regarding 12 inches from the surface area and keep a stable, sweeping motion. This technique ensures you do not miss any type of areas or apply too much pressure in one location.

For especially persistent discolorations, you may require to repeat the process or utilize a much more concentrated cleaner.

Lastly, wash the area thoroughly after cleaning. This action prevents any type of deposit from staying on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.

Best Practices for Plastic Siding



Vinyl house siding is a prominent selection for homeowners as a result of its toughness and low maintenance requirements. Nonetheless, to maintain it looking its ideal, you'll require to push laundry it periodically.

Begin by preparing the area-- remove any furnishings, plants, or challenges near your home. Next off, select a pressure washing machine with a nozzle that delivers a wide spray; generally, a 25-degree nozzle works well.

Before you begin, check a small section to guarantee your settings won't damage the siding. Keep the pressure below 2000 PSI to avoid any dents or fractures. Start from all-time low and work your way up, washing in sections to avoid touches.

Make use of a cleaning agent specifically developed for plastic exterior siding to aid remove dirt and mold and mildew. Use it with your pressure washer or a pump sprayer, allowing it to sit for around 10 minutes.

Afterward, rinse completely from the top down, making certain all cleaning agent is gotten rid of. Finally, check the house siding for any kind of missed areas or persistent stains that might need extra attention.

Routine upkeep will certainly keep your vinyl siding looking fresh and extend its lifespan, making it a beneficial financial investment for your home.
